Is Asymptomatic Bacteriuria a Risk Factor for Prosthetic Joint Infection?
Background. Infection is a major complication after total joint arthroplasty. The urinary tract is a possible source of surgical site contamination, but the role of asymptomatic bacteriuria (ASB) before elective surgery and the subsequent risk of infection is poorly understood.
